Nuevo León, Chihuahua and Coahuila are the three most attractive entities in the country for nearshoring .
These three states in Mexico stand out for their high participation in the industrial real estate market and their leadership in industrial GDP. They also stand out for their manufacturing exports and attraction of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) , according to the Industrial Development Index (IDI) 2023, prepared by FINSA.
Nuevo León leads the country in industrial infrastructure with 1,590 hectares and an average annual growth of 100 hectares. It is followed by Chihuahua (1,020 hectares), Baja California (730) and the State of Mexico (690).
The highest annual growth rates are in Chihuahua (42 hectares), Baja California (32.6), Coahuila (32.2) and the State of Mexico (31.6).
The four states with the greatest potential to position themselves among the top five states with the largest industrial space in the coming years are Coahuila, Guanajuato, Jalisco and Querétaro.
The border stands out for its industrial space , the Bajío for its levels of innovation and rule of law, and the central region for its qualified talent.
Nuevo León is the leading entity in terms of industrial warehouse inventory with 14.5 million square meters (m2) and the fastest growing with an average of 860,000 m2 of new construction in the last five years.
This entity is followed by Chihuahua with 9.6 million, Baja California with 6.9 million and Tamaulipas with 6.6 million square meters.

Likewise, 53% of manufacturing exports come from Chihuahua (14%), Coahuila (12%), Baja California (10%), Nuevo León (10%) and Tamaulipas (7%).
In contrast, the 10 entities that contribute the least together barely account for 4% of industrial GDP.
